This monograph provides a comprehensive mathematical framework for modeling heavy metal transport in soil. Drawing on advection-diffusion equations, exponential decay models, and advanced numerical techniques, the book bridges theoretical mathematics with practical applications in environmental science and policy. Through detailed derivations, simulations, and case studies it demonstrates how predictive models can forecast plume migration, optimize remediation, and quantify climate change impacts.
Key innovations include stochastic uncertainty analysis, machine learning integration for parameter estimation, and scalable frameworks for site-to-regional assessments. The text explores real-world implications, from cost reductions in cleanup (up to 31% savings) to environmental justice considerations, equipping readers with tools to mitigate risks to human health and ecosystems.
Intended for environmental scientists, mathematicians, engineers, and policymakers, this work synthesizes decades of research while proposing forward-looking scenarios, such as microplastic-metal interactions and real-time sensor assimilation. With rigorous analytical solutions, computational efficiency (O (n log n) complexity), and interdisciplinary connections to hydrogeology and soil chemistry, it offers a robust toolkit for sustainable soil management. Ultimately, the book transforms abstract equations into actionable strategies for a cleaner planet, emphasizing mathematics as a language of environmental hope and stewardship.

About the Author
Dr. Busayamas Pimpunchat is an Assistant Professor in Applied Mathematics at the Industrial Mathematics Research Group (IMRG), Department of Mathematics, School of Sciences, King Mongkut’s Institute of Technology Ladkrabang (KMITL), Thailand. Her expertise spans *applied mathematics, data analytics, financial modelling, and risk management, with strong emphasis on real-world applications in **finance, insurance, and environmental systems. Her research in *financial specialization* focuses on *credit risk modelling, expected credit loss (ECL) calculation, and actuarial-based financial management, particularly for financial management and debt-related companies. She has applied **stochastic processes, probability models, and machine learning techniques* to support decision-making under uncertainty and regulatory compliance. In addition, she has contributed to projects involving the *calculation of contribution rates* for employers and employees under Thailand’s *Workmen’s Compensation Fund*, integrating actuarial principles with policy and labour risk assessment.
Beyond finance, her work includes *environmental and pollution modelling, as well as **artificial intelligence and data science applications* such as Support Vector Machines (SVM) and deep learning models. She has held several leadership roles in academic and analytics centers and received the *Hope Award* from Kyushu University, Japan. Her interdisciplinary research bridges *mathematics, finance, insurance, and public policy*, financial mathematics in in PDE, delivering practical and sustainable solutions for industry and society.
Dr. V. Govindan is an Associate Professor in the Department of Mathematics at Hindustan Institute of Technology and Science, Chennai, India, with over 16 years of teaching and research experience. His expertise includes stability of functional and differential equations, fractional differential equations, and nanofluid dynamics. He holds a PhD from Periyar University (2017) on functional equations in defined in Various normed spaces, an MPhil (2009), MSc (2006), and BSc (2004) from the same institution. Dr. V.Govindan has authored 243 research articles (162 in Scopus/SCIE), with 1413 Google Scholar citations, an h-index of 16, and two patent. He has served as a Visiting Professor at KMITL, Thailand (2025), and held positions at DMI St. John the Baptist University, Malawi (2020-2023), and Sri Vidya Mandir Arts & Science College, India (2009-2020).He received the Best researcher award in the international conference at Dubai (2023) ,he received the young scientist award in the international conference at University of Malaya, Malaysia (2024) ,and he received the Sri Ramanujan best researcher award at Thammasat University ,Thailand (2025). Passionate about mentoring and interdisciplinary research, he reviews for journals and has organized many conferences on mathematical modelling.
Dr. N. Avinash is an Assistant Professor in the Department of Mathematics at Sacred Heart College (Autonomous), Tirupattur, India, with 9 years of professional experience. Specializing in fractional calculus, difference equations, and epidemic modeling, he has a PhD in Difference Equations (viva-voce 2025) from Sacred Heart College, MSc (2016) from S.T. Hindu College, and BSc (2014) from Lekshmipuram College. He has published 11 papers in SCIE/Scopus-indexed journals on topics like COVID-19 and monkeypox models, authored 3 books, and holds 1 patent on team interaction analysis. Dr. Avinash has 12 communicated papers, serves as a peer reviewer for Scientific Reports (13 manuscripts), and has organized 3 conferences/workshops. He has attended 27 conferences and 17 FDPs, earning awards like All India Rank 75 in CSIR-NET and a Lifetime Membership in AARM. Proficient in LaTeX, Maple, SPSS, and AI tools, he focuses on translating research into practical applications for public health.
Dr. Mustafa Inc is a Full Professor in the Department of Mathematics at Firat University, Elazig, Turkey, since 2013. His research interests include approximate solutions of PDEs and ODEs, fractional dynamics, numerical and analytical methods for differential equations, optical solitons, nonlinear optics, Lie symmetry analysis, and stability analysis. He holds a PhD (2002), MSc (1997), and BSc (1992) in Mathematics from Firat University. Dr. Inc has supervised 9 PhD theses, authored 493 articles with 16,000 citations and an h-index of 52, and reviews for over 30 international journals. He served as Associate Professor (2009-2013), Assistant Professor (2003-2009), and Visiting Professor at Biruni University (2021-2023). Recognized for his contributions to applied mathematics and environmental.
